Assume the single-compartment model defined in Subsection 8.2.2: If C(t) is the concentration of the solute at time t, then dC/dt is given by (8.57); that is, dC dt = q V (CI C) where q, V, and CI are defined as in Subsection 8.2.2. Use the graphical approach to discuss the stability of the equilibrium C = CI .
